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What does the high assessed value actually indicate?
A: A municipal assessed value in the top 3% city-wide generally reflects the city’s opinion of the property’s worth relative to others, often based on lot size, improvements, and recent sales in the area. It’s a key data point for understanding the property’s tax base and official valuation.

Q: The home sold for $700k in 2020. How should I interpret that today?
A: That past sale price shows the property commanded a premium price at that time, placing it in the top tier of the market. It provides a historical benchmark for the home’s perceived value in a different interest rate environment, useful for understanding its market trajectory.

Q: How does the lot size compare practically?
A: At over 6,200 sqft, the lot is substantially larger than many in newer subdivisions. This translates to more backyard space, greater distance from neighbours, and potentially more landscaping or recreational options.

Q: The property is noted as having a "renovated basement." What should I ask about this?
A: It’s important to verify the scope, quality, and permits for the renovation. Ask what was done (e.g., finishing, structural, moisture-proofing), when it was completed, and if it includes a secondary suite or additional legal bedrooms.
